'use strict'
// Generic set-piece factory. A "set-piece" is a curated, theme-specific
// showpiece that inlines a short linear narrative beat-chain into the
// dungeon. Unlike keyDoor (Metroidvania gating) or monsterBattle (random
// engagement), set-pieces are one-shot story moments — the entry edge
// is consumed on use, and on loop-back the player sees a post-visit
// bypass instead.
//
// Structure produced (fan-out from the matched edge's source `a`):
//
// a ──entry (oneTime)──► setup ─► stealth ─► escape ─┐
// a ──decline (oneTime)─► decline_node ──────────────┼──► b
// a ──bypass (prereq.visited=b)─► bypass_node ───────┘
//
// The intermediate decline_node / bypass_node exist purely to work
// around graphlib's single-edge-per-pair limitation — they carry a
// one-line narrative beat of their own so they're not dead weight.
const NODE_STEP = 'setpiece_step'
const NODE_EXIT = 'setpiece_exit'
const EDGE_ENTRY = 'setpiece_entry'
const EDGE_DECL = 'setpiece_decline'
const EDGE_BYP = 'setpiece_bypass'
const EDGE_INNER = 'setpiece'
function macro (name, ctx) { return { $macro: [name, ctx] } }
function nodeIdExpr (role, beat) {
return { $eval: '"sp_' + role + '_' + beat + '_" + ($$iter + 1)' }
}
// The set-piece's three "first-edges" out of `a` (entry, decline, bypass)
// all inherit the matched edge's edgeId when it has one. This preserves
// any paired backtracks elsewhere in the graph that were keyed on that
// edgeId — traversing the set-piece satisfies them the same way the
// original a→b would have. Falls back to a generated id if the matched
// edge was unpaired.
function inheritedEdgeIdExpr (role) {
const fallback = '"e_sp_' + role + '_" + ($$iter + 1)'
return { $eval: '$e.label.edgeId || (' + fallback + ')' }
}
function setpieceIdExpr (role) {
return { $eval: '"sp_' + role + '_" + ($$iter + 1)' }
}
// spec = {
// name: string — rule name (e.g. 'setpiece-space-opera-rescue')
// role: string — short role prefix for node/edge ids (e.g. 'rescue')
// beatMacros: string[3] — macro names for the 3 linear beats
// entryMacro: string — macro name for entry affordance/narrative
// declineMacro: string — macro name for decline node/edge
// bypassMacro: string — macro name for bypass node/edge
// displayLabel: string — short graphviz label for the set-piece (optional)
// }
// opts = standard rule opts: { weight, limit, delay }
function makeSetpiece (spec, opts) {
opts = opts || {}
const role = spec.role
const spId = setpieceIdExpr(role)
// Shared across entry / decline / bypass first-edges: whichever one the
// player takes, the matched edge's paired backtrack (if any) is satisfied,
// and the oneTime gates close together so mission-engagement is a single
// commit-point. See inheritedEdgeIdExpr comments above.
const sharedEdgeId = inheritedEdgeIdExpr(role)
const ctx = spId
const beatId = function (beat) { return nodeIdExpr(role, 'b' + beat) }
const declineNodeId = nodeIdExpr(role, 'decline')
const bypassNodeId = nodeIdExpr(role, 'bypass')
const stepLabel = function (beat, macroName) {
return {
type: NODE_STEP,
setpieceId: spId,
beat: beat,
nodeId: beatId(beat),
text: macro(macroName, spId),
dot: { label: role + ' ' + beat, shape: 'octagon' }
}
}
const declineLabel = {
type: NODE_EXIT,
setpieceId: spId,
role: 'decline',
nodeId: declineNodeId,
text: macro(spec.declineMacro, spId),
dot: { label: role + ' (decline)', shape: 'trapezium', style: 'dashed' }
}
const bypassLabel = {
type: NODE_EXIT,
setpieceId: spId,
role: 'bypass',
nodeId: bypassNodeId,
text: macro(spec.bypassMacro, spId),
dot: { label: role + ' (bypass)', shape: 'trapezium', style: 'dotted' }
}
return {
name: spec.name,
weight: opts.weight,
limit: opts.limit,
delay: opts.delay,
lhs: {
node: [
// Both endpoints must be plain rooms. This excludes leaves
// (potion, key, door, dead_end) where the player would be
// stranded after traversing the set-piece — those nodes have
// only gated backtracks out, and the set-piece route doesn't
// satisfy any of those gates. Also excludes start / win since
// rooms aren't either of those.
{ id: 'a', label: { type: 'room' } },
// Capture b's nodeId so the bypass edge can prereq.visited on it.
{ id: 'b', label: { $and: [{ type: 'room' }, { nodeId: '(.+)' }] } }
],
// Capture the matched edge as `e` so the RHS can inherit its
// edgeId onto the set-piece's first-edges. No $not:edgeId guard —
// we now handle paired edges by inheritance instead of refusal.
edge: [{ v: 'a', w: 'b', label: { type: 'path' }, id: 'e' }]
},
rhs: {
node: [
{ id: 'a' },
{ id: 'b' },
{ id: 'setup', label: stepLabel(1, spec.beatMacros[0]) },
{ id: 'stealth', label: stepLabel(2, spec.beatMacros[1]) },
{ id: 'escape', label: stepLabel(3, spec.beatMacros[2]) },
{ id: 'dec', label: declineLabel },
{ id: 'byp', label: bypassLabel }
],
edge: [
// Entry: oneTime, carries the entry affordance macro. edgeId is
// inherited from the matched edge so paired backtracks keep
// working.
{ v: 'a', w: 'setup', label: {
type: EDGE_ENTRY,
setpieceId: spId,
edgeId: sharedEdgeId,
oneTime: true,
link: macro(spec.entryMacro, spId),
dot: { label: role + ' enter', style: 'bold', color: '#6a3' }
} },
// Linear inner path; distinct type so refine-stage ignores it.
{ v: 'setup', w: 'stealth', label: { type: EDGE_INNER, setpieceId: spId } },
{ v: 'stealth', w: 'escape', label: { type: EDGE_INNER, setpieceId: spId } },
{ v: 'escape', w: 'b', label: { type: EDGE_INNER, setpieceId: spId } },
// Decline: oneTime, routed via an intermediate node to avoid a
// parallel a→b edge. Shares edgeId with entry, so taking either
// commits the player (both become unavailable on revisit).
{ v: 'a', w: 'dec', label: {
type: EDGE_DECL,
setpieceId: spId,
edgeId: sharedEdgeId,
oneTime: true,
dot: { label: role + ' decline', style: 'dashed', color: '#b85' }
} },
{ v: 'dec', w: 'b', label: { type: EDGE_INNER, setpieceId: spId } },
// Bypass: appears only once b has been visited (via entry or
// decline). Routed via intermediate node for the same parallel-edge
// reason. Not oneTime — available on every revisit. Shares the
// inherited edgeId so taking bypass also satisfies any paired
// backtrack keyed on the original edge.
{ v: 'a', w: 'byp', label: {
type: EDGE_BYP,
setpieceId: spId,
edgeId: sharedEdgeId,
prereq: { visited: '${b.match.nodeId[1]}' },
dot: { label: role + ' bypass', style: 'dotted', color: '#58b' }
} },
{ v: 'byp', w: 'b', label: { type: EDGE_INNER, setpieceId: spId } }
]
}
}
}
module.exports = {
makeSetpiece,
NODE_STEP,
NODE_EXIT,
EDGE_ENTRY,
EDGE_DECL,
EDGE_BYP,
EDGE_INNER
}
